Discovering Your Top 10 Superfoods
Creating a list of general top 10 superfoods is pretty easy. You just have to gather together a list of foods with the healthiest nutritional values and you’re all set. But what good is a list like that if it doesn’t match your lifestyle or suit your tastes? Let’s face it, regardless of how healthy tomatoes are, not everyone likes them. Building a list of your own personal superfoods is easier than you might think. All you have to do is figure out what foods offer the nutrition you need and which ones you like the most. The easiest way to break it down is by the type of food.
Get the Energy You Need
If you subsist on fast foods, you are probably getting more fats than anything else. Of the three major types of energy your body needs, fats are the poorest kind. They burn quickly, but also tend to get stored in excess as body fat. Carbohydrates are good for short term energy and many athletes require them. But proteins are what many people are missing. To get vital proteins, you might find that fish such as salmon or tilapia suit you well. If you don’t like fish, chicken is another great source along with dairy such as milk and cheese.
Getting Your Vitamins
Fruits and vegetables are the best source of vitamins you can get. Oranges and grapefruits are great examples of fruits which have more than just flavor to offer. Vitamins are great for so many things, including maintaining a healthy immune system. If you prefer leafy greens, you can get loads of nutrition from foods like spinach or broccoli. And veggies make a great snack since many of them require more fat to digest than they give back. Your top 10 superfoods list should always contain plenty of fruits and vegetables, something that many Americans lack.
